    It means you can not synchronize multichannel analog audio output and video on BDP9700. But you can synchronize audio and video if both are output from HDMI (digital). Same "feature" as on BDP9600.

    I made this post here because many users still hope that synchronization of multichannel analog audio output and video will be available with new firmware on 9600, but if this is not available on 9700 it will very unlikely be on 9600.
    Technically it must be possible as OPPO BDP-93 and 95 (they had same MT8530 Mediatek series bluray player core chip as BDP9600) had analog output delay possible: http://oppodigital.com/blu-ray-bdp-9...-52-0707B.aspx
    Oppo noted in firmware release notes that they had corrected analog output delay with new firmware.
